body{color:var(--ml-color-text-primary);font-size:var(--ml-text-body);line-height:var(--ml-leading-body);font-weight:400;letter-spacing:var(--ml-letter-soft);-webkit-font-smoothing:antialiased;text-rendering:optimizeLegibility;background-color:var(--ml-color-warm-paper)}::selection{background:#d8c6b147;color:var(--ml-color-soft-charcoal)}.ml-hero-heading,.ml-display-heading,.ml-section-heading{font-family:var(--font-heading-family);color:var(--ml-color-soft-charcoal);font-weight:400;letter-spacing:var(--ml-letter-breathing);text-wrap:balance;margin:0}.ml-hero-heading{font-size:var(--ml-text-hero);line-height:var(--ml-leading-hero);max-width:11ch;margin-bottom:var(--ml-space-lg)}.ml-display-heading{font-size:var(--ml-text-display);line-height:var(--ml-leading-display);max-width:13ch;margin-bottom:var(--ml-space-md)}.ml-section-heading{font-size:var(--ml-text-heading);line-height:1.18;max-width:14ch;margin-bottom:var(--ml-space-md)}.ml-reading-flow,.ml-body-copy,.rte p{font-size:var(--ml-text-body);line-height:var(--ml-leading-body);color:var(--ml-color-text-secondary);max-width:var(--ml-reading-width);margin-bottom:var(--ml-space-lg);letter-spacing:var(--ml-letter-soft)}.ml-contemplative-copy{font-size:var(--ml-text-body-lg);line-height:var(--ml-leading-relaxed);color:var(--ml-color-text-secondary);max-width:var(--ml-reading-width-narrow);margin-bottom:var(--ml-space-xl)}.ml-supporting-text{font-size:var(--ml-text-body-sm);line-height:1.9;color:var(--ml-color-text-soft);max-width:52ch}.ml-text-breathing>*+*{margin-top:var(--ml-space-lg)}.ml-reading-flow p+p,.rte p+p{margin-top:var(--ml-space-md)}.ml-space-after-thought{margin-bottom:var(--ml-space-xl)}.ml-space-before-thought{margin-top:var(--ml-space-xl)}.ml-cinematic-pause{margin-top:var(--ml-space-2xl);margin-bottom:var(--ml-space-2xl)}.ml-reading-width{max-width:var(--ml-reading-width)}.ml-reading-width-narrow{max-width:var(--ml-reading-width-narrow)}.ml-headline-soft{opacity:.96}.ml-copy-soft{opacity:.84}.ml-copy-whisper{opacity:.68}.ml-hero-typography{display:flex;flex-direction:column;align-items:flex-start;justify-content:center;gap:var(--ml-space-md)}.ml-soft-cta{font-size:.95rem;letter-spacing:.02em;line-height:1.4;font-weight:500}.ml-atmospheric-quote{font-size:clamp(1.4rem,2vw,2rem);line-height:1.6;letter-spacing:-.02em;color:var(--ml-color-soft-charcoal);max-width:18ch}.ml-reading-flow ul,.ml-reading-flow ol{margin-top:var(--ml-space-md);margin-bottom:var(--ml-space-lg);padding-left:1.5rem}.ml-reading-flow li+li{margin-top:.75rem}a{color:inherit;text-decoration-color:#2e2b282e;text-underline-offset:.16em;transition:color var(--ml-motion-medium) var(--ml-ease-soft),text-decoration-color var(--ml-motion-medium) var(--ml-ease-soft)}a:hover{text-decoration-color:#2e2b286b}@media screen and (max-width:1024px){.ml-hero-heading{max-width:12ch}.ml-contemplative-copy{max-width:100%}}@media screen and (max-width:768px){body{font-size:1rem;line-height:2}.ml-hero-heading{max-width:9ch;margin-bottom:var(--ml-space-md)}.ml-display-heading{max-width:11ch}.ml-section-heading{max-width:12ch}.ml-reading-flow,.ml-body-copy,.rte p{line-height:2;margin-bottom:var(--ml-space-md)}.ml-contemplative-copy{font-size:1.12rem;line-height:2.1}.ml-cinematic-pause{margin-top:var(--ml-space-xl);margin-bottom:var(--ml-space-xl)}}@media(prefers-reduced-motion:reduce){*{transition-duration:0ms!important}}
/*# sourceMappingURL=/cdn/shop/t/25/assets/mirellis-typography.css.map */
